Which trust signals actually carry weight at 10,000 pounds plus
At this level, trust has to match consequence. If the buyer is risking downtime, compliance issues, budget scrutiny or a poor rollout, you need to show proof that answers those risks directly. Start by asking which parts of the purchase would be hardest for the buyer to justify if something went wrong.
That is why support boundaries, response expectations and after-sales clarity matter early, not as an afterthought. Serious buyers want to know what happens after delivery and after the invoice is paid. Working with high-ticket B2B clients across industrial and technical sectors, we tend to see the same pattern – the sites generating the strongest enquiry quality from their lead generation programmes are the ones that treat post-sale proof as a conversion asset, not an afterthought. Do not assume buyers will ask later. If support terms affect risk, put them where buyers can see them before they enquire.

- Compliance and technical risk: certifications, standards, test data, spec sheets, operating tolerances, safety documentation.
- Financial and supplier risk: warranty terms, payment logic, company details, service coverage, escalation paths.
- Operational risk: delivery windows, installation method, commissioning process, training, service response times.
- Approval risk: case studies, referenceable use cases, sector fit, proof the equipment works in conditions like theirs.
If you are choosing what to improve first, prioritise the proof closest to the buyer’s biggest exposure. A polished homepage helps less than a product page with clear compliance evidence, installation detail and support terms.
Why generic trust elements fail in high-ticket equipment sales
We see this consistently across the high-ticket equipment sites we audit: teams add more reassurance because enquiries feel soft, but the issue is rarely a lack of badges. It is a lack of proof that holds up under scrutiny.
There is a useful distinction we come back to with clients. Decoration implies credibility. Proof reduces risk. Generic trust elements – a review badge, a few logos in the footer, a broad quality claim – are built for low-friction buying. They create a decent first impression, but they do not answer the question a serious buyer is actually asking: can we rely on this supplier when the stakes are real?
What changes this is what we call the Risk-Reducing Proof Standard: every trust signal on a high-ticket product page should be verifiable by procurement, defensible in a technical review, and specific enough to survive a pushback from operations. If it cannot pass that test, it is too weak for a 10,000 pounds plus sale.
The trade-off is worth understanding: broad reassurance can help early attention, but expensive technical purchases need stronger evidence to convert. Keep the basic credibility cues – they still matter for first impressions – but do not mistake them for decision-stage proof. Watch for pages that look trustworthy yet leave obvious buyer questions unanswered.
When that gap stays open, we see a predictable outcome: sales cycles slow, enquiries become more tentative and more wrong-fit leads get through. And if you want a wider view of what buyers need before they will even enquire, it helps to look at trust as a risk system, not a design layer.

Where those signals need to appear in the buying journey
Good trust signals fail all the time because they are buried in the wrong place. Buyers should not have to dig through PDFs, chase sales for basic warranty detail or wait for a call to understand installation logic. If the information changes the buying decision, place it where the decision is happening.
A practical way to think about this is by stage. Product and category pages should reduce initial doubt, while quote forms and enquiry paths should reduce hesitation at the point of action. Sales follow-up should deepen proof for internal review. A common example we encounter: a buyer is comparing two suppliers for a specialist machine. One site looks modern but keeps service response, commissioning steps and warranty exclusions vague. The other shows lead times, installation responsibilities, support coverage and a case study from a similar operating environment. You already know which one is easier to shortlist and defend internally.
- On product pages: specs, compliance, operating conditions, warranty summary, installation overview.
- Near enquiry points: delivery logic, support response, who handles setup, what happens next.
- In downloadable or sales assets: full technical data, service terms, implementation detail, sector-fit proof.
Check whether your strongest proof appears before enquiry, not only after a sales conversation starts. And do not bury operational detail on a support page if it is one of the main reasons buyers hesitate.

Trust-to-Risk Ratio: a simple way to audit your current proof
If you want a fast diagnostic, compare the buyer’s risk with the strength of the proof you give them. Check whether your current signals are proportionate to the spend, complexity and operational consequence of the sale.
WEBDIGITA Trust-to-Risk Diagnostic: use this to spot where your current reassurance is too weak for the level of buyer scrutiny.
| Buyer risk area | Weak signal | Strong signal | What the buyer can verify |
|---|---|---|---|
| Financial reassurance | General claims about quality | Clear warranty terms, ownership details, support coverage | What is covered, for how long, and who is accountable |
| Compliance and technical proof | Badge without context | Standards, certifications, test data, detailed specifications | Whether the equipment meets required technical or regulatory needs |
| Delivery and installation confidence | Vague promise of fast delivery | Lead times, commissioning steps, site requirements, training detail | How rollout will work in practice |
| After-sales support | “Ongoing support available” | Response terms, service process, escalation route, maintenance boundaries | What happens when something needs fixing |
If your ratio is weak, fix the proof nearest to the risk first. We would not start by adding more generic reassurance when buyers still cannot verify the basics that matter to procurement, operations or technical sign-off.
